How Much Money Do You Need to Run a Website?

When it comes to starting a website, there are a lot of costs that you need to factor in. From domain registration to hosting, there are a lot of costs associated with website ownership. However, not all costs are created equal. In this blog post, we will explore the different types of expenses that go into running a website and what you should expect to spend on each one. This information will help you determine how much money you need to start your website and guide you through the decision-making process of choosing which type of hosting is right for you.

Understanding Website Costs

There are a few factors to consider when estimating website costs. The following are the most important:

Domain name registration and hosting fees:

The first step in estimating website costs is to determine how much you’ll need to spend on domain name registration and hosting fees. Generally, these costs will range from $10-$25 per year. It’s important to remember that this figure only represents the initial investment – you’ll likely need to spend more money on additional domain name registrations and hosting services as your site grows.

Web design and development services:

Once you’ve registered your domain name, you’ll need to find a web designer or developer who can create a custom website for you. These services can range in price from $50-$500 per hour, depending on the complexity of your project. It’s important to remember that these costs don’t include graphics or programming services – those items will often be billed separately.

Traffic levels:

Another major factor impacting website costs is the amount of traffic your site receives. A site with high traffic levels will typically require more resources (in terms of server space, bandwidth, etc.) than a site with lower traffic levels. This means that you’ll likely need to budget for higher-traffic sites by paying higher-priced web design and development services. A website rank checker can help you estimate the traffic levels for your site.

Advertising costs:

Finally, you’ll need to budget for the cost of advertising on your website. This can range from a few hundred dollars per month to tens of thousands of dollars per year.


HTML/CSS is a markup language and style sheet language used for creating web pages and applications. They are used to create the structure, appearance, and behavior of a web page or application. HTML is the foundation of all websites and uses tags to identify elements on a webpage. CSS sets the style for these tags, which allow you to create sophisticated layouts and designs. Additionally, HTML5 introduces new elements that allow you to create more interactive websites.

How to Evaluate Website Pricing?

When you are considering how much money to spend on starting a website, there are a few factors to take into account. The cost of hosting and maintaining your website, as well as the price of ads that can be placed on your site, will play a role in determining how much money you need to put into your project. Here’s a look at some of the costs associated with running a website:

– Hosting and maintenance: One of the most important costs when it comes to starting or running a website is the cost of hosting and maintaining it. This can include monthly fees for web space and bandwidth, as well as ongoing marketing and support costs for keeping your site up-to-date and functional.

– Web design fees: Unless you have experience designing websites yourself, you’ll likely need to hire someone to create one for you. These fees can vary significantly based on the level of customization and features included in your site design.

– Domain names: Another key expense associated with starting or running a website is the cost of acquiring a domain name. This is especially true if you plan to sell products or services through your site.

– Web advertisement costs: Once you’ve designed and launched your website, you’ll likely need to place ads on it in order to generate traffic and revenue. These costs can vary significantly based on the size and location of your target audience.

Server Rentals and Hosting

A website can cost anywhere from a couple hundred dollars to tens of thousands of dollars to build. In this article, we will discuss how much money you need to run a website and some of the things you may need in order to do so. You may be wondering how much money you need to start hosting your own website.

One thing to keep in mind is that hosting your own website does not have to be expensive. There are a number of affordable web hosting companies available on the market today. Another option is to rent a server from a hosting company. This will require more research since different hosting companies offer different pricing models and features.

Regardless of which option you choose, it is important that you have an idea of what you are looking for before making any purchases or signing up for services. This includes understanding what features are included with each package and whether those features meet your needs. It is also important to compare prices and features between different providers so that you can find the best deal for your needs.

Google AdSense and Other Advertising Options

Google AdSense is one of the most popular and effective advertising options. It allows you to place ads on your website for a fee. Other advertising options include displaying ads on other websites, placing ads in print publications, and running classified ads. To determine how much money, you need to run a website, factor in your budget and the traffic your site receives.


If you’re thinking of starting a website, it’s important to have an idea of how much money you’ll need to set things up and maintain it. Depending on the type of website you’re planning, costs can range from nothing up to hundreds, even thousands of dollars per year. However, with some careful budgeting and some creative ideas for revenue generation, you can get started without spending a fortune. So, what are you waiting for? Start planning your website now!